Kim Jong-un in Russia for Vladimir Putin summit (BBC)

North Korean leader Kim Jong-un has arrived in the far east of Russia for a summit with President Vladimir Putin.

Mr Kim arrived in the Pacific Coast city of Vladivostok for his first talks with the Russian president by train.

He was welcomed by officials with a traditional offering of bread and salt.

The Kremlin says they will discuss the Korean peninsula’s “nuclear problem”, but analysts say Mr Kim is also seeking support after talks with US President Donald Trump collapsed. Read more
